Abstract
The mechanical investigation of polymer hybrid composite materials under varying filler loading conditions was conducted.
The hybrid composites were formed which constituted by S-glass fiber with natural reinforcement of hemp fabric with natural
filler of seashell reinforced epoxy system. The tensile, flexural, hardness, and impact properties of hybrid specimens were
tested as per the ASTM standard. The secondary reinforcement as seashell filler was used to form hybrid at varying weight
percentage, namely, 3%, 6%, and 9%. Scanning electron microscope study was also carried out on the material developed to get
the understanding of fracture that has taken place in filler/matrix and reinforcement interaction under mechanical loads. The test
results reveal that the mechanical properties of the hybrid composites have been greatly influenced by filler used in the material
system.
